The Foundation of Healthy Skin: Collagen and Hydration
Collagen, a primary structural protein in the body, is fundamental to the integrity and appearance of our skin. As we age, our natural collagen production declines, leading to visible signs of aging such as wrinkles, reduced elasticity, and decreased skin hydration. This is where collagen peptides, derived from sources like tuna, come into play. Tuna collagen peptides are small, easily absorbable fragments of collagen that can signal the body to increase its own collagen synthesis.
Tuna Collagen Peptides: A Deep Dive into Skin Benefits
Scientific studies and product formulations consistently highlight the positive impact of tuna collagen peptides on skin health. Research indicates that tuna collagen peptides have the potential to significantly improve skin hydration, elasticity, and density. A notable clinical trial found that women taking tuna collagen peptides experienced improved skin hydration, elasticity, and density, alongside a reduction in water loss. This suggests that tuna collagen peptides not only add moisture but also help the skin retain it more effectively.
Furthermore, tuna collagen peptides are recognized for their ability to enhance the skin's natural moisturizing factors. Oral supplementation of collagen peptides improves skin hydration by increasing these factors within the stratum corneum, the outermost layer of the skin. This dual action – boosting intrinsic hydration and preventing water loss – is crucial for maintaining a supple and dewy complexion.

Source and Quality Matter: Understanding Tuna Collagen
The source of collagen is an important consideration. Tuna collagen is derived from marine sources, specifically from fish like bigeye tuna (*Thunnus obesus*) and yellowfin tuna (*Thunnus albacares*). Studies have focused on extracting type I collagen from discarded tuna skin, confirming its structure and properties. The hydrolysates and peptide fractions of bigeye tuna skin collagen have been successfully studied for their bioactive potential. Similarly, yellowfin tuna skin is recommended for producing bioactive peptides with desirable functional properties for ease of use.
